LaPmGe is a rare-earth intermetallic ceramic compound combining lanthanum, promethium, and germanium elements. This is a research-phase material studied primarily for its potential in specialized high-temperature applications and as a model compound for understanding rare-earth intermetallic behavior. The material family is of interest to materials scientists exploring novel phononic, thermal, or electronic properties that may not be accessible through conventional ceramics or metal alloys.
